Key Features of User-Friendly Kitchen Interfaces
Understanding usability features in kitchen technology is crucial for a comfortable cooking experience. Modern interfaces incorporate intuitive controls to enhance interaction.
Touchscreen Displays
Touchscreens are prevalent in kitchen appliances, offering clear visual menus and easy navigation. They simplify settings adjustments and provide feedback instantly, enhancing overall interface design.
Voice Control Capabilities
Voice command technology allows users to operate appliances without physical contact. This feature increases accessibility, especially for those who may face mobility challenges or are multitasking in the kitchen.
Mobile App Integration
The integration of mobile applications with kitchen devices elevates usability. These apps not only offer remote control but also enable users to receive notifications and updates, thus fitting seamlessly into a smart home ecosystem. They provide flexibility and convenience, allowing the user to interact with kitchen appliances even when away from home.

User Testimonials and Case Studies
Exploring user experiences provides insightful perspectives into how smart appliance interfaces operate in various real-world scenarios. Case studies involve testing appliance usability, providing concrete examples of how technology performs beyond theoretical evaluations.
A central theme emerging from testimonials is the importance of intuitive design. Users consistently highlight how user-friendly designs significantly enhance their kitchen interactions. For instance, individuals with limited technical skills report seamless navigation on interfaces when adjusting settings or initiating commands. Such feedback underscores the need for accessible technology.
Demonstrative examples from real-world applications emphasize how efficiently appliances integrate into daily routines. Take Katie, a working mom who uses a smart oven synced with her phone app. With tight schedules, she preheats her oven on the way home from work, saving precious time. This illustrates the practicality and convenience of app-driven kitchen technology.
However, testimonials also reveal challenges. Some users mention initial difficulties syncing devices with networks or deciphering complex manuals. These experiences highlight areas for improvement, encouraging manufacturers to refine their designs for plug-and-play usability.
